It stops key cloning and hacking



With car theft increasing, a ghost immobiliser can prevent the loss of your pride and joy. It works by stopping the vehicle from starting until a particular pin code sequence is entered. The device is becoming increasingly popular, especially in modern keyless entry vehicles. Insurance companies often require that the device be installed and it can lower monthly premiums.

Unlike standard immobilisers, the ghost is undetectable to thieves as it functions in complete silence and doesn't emit radio signals. It is also extremely difficult to hack since it operates with the CAN Bus. The CAN bus is the internal system of communication that connects all the electronic components of your car. This system can be exploited by thieves to bypass standard immobilisers using relay attacks.

The Ghost utilizes buttons on your vehicle, like those on the steering wheel, doors and the centre console, to create a custom pin configuration that has to be entered to disable. You can even make the sequence up to 20 presses long, which makes it almost impossible for a thief to get around it. The device is TASSA verified, meaning that it's one of the most trusted products in the market.

It's discreet

Contrary to other security systems, Ghost does not rely on the alarm system or the key fob to stop your vehicle from starting. Instead, it communicates with your car's ECU and CAN data network to stop the engine from running. This is a more sophisticated method of protecting that's why it is so difficult to get into your car using this device. It can be used in conjunction with an electronic tracking device so you can get a complete picture about your vehicle.

The system is also discreet It does not utilize LED indicators or key fobs. Instead, it utilizes the buttons already present in your vehicle to generate a PIN code sequence that must be entered before your vehicle is able to start. This is a great alternative to traditional antitheft devices like steering-wheel locks. It is a safe way to prevent hacking and key cloning.
